Default 960 3l 24v in a 245!

Hi guys,

Ive bought a 90' 960 with the intention of putting its engine and box in my 89' 245,

My main concern is if the engine fitted to the 960 is as reliable as the 245 redblock B200E engine?

Also is the autobox fitted to the 960 the same as that fitted to an auto late model 240, i would make custom engine mounts so that the box fits in the same place it would as it would if it were fitted to a 240 engine, this would allow me to fit 240 driveshafts and engine mounts, is there enough space to do this?

Default RE: 960 3l 24v in a 245!

Surley it is a 1991? I have never heard of a 960 1990. Anyway, the gearbox is totally different and electronic. The engine is no way near as reliable as an old B200E, but is it of course about twice as much fun!

Default RE: 960 3l 24v in a 245!


Ben why not wait for the 164 which should have the room for the engine (basically same size and no turbo). The only problem would be matching the gearbox to the front of the tunnel space. It might go but you will need to feed the three connectors on the side of the gearbox to the gearbox CU. That should make for quite a challenge. Just think 204 bhp in a 164!! I bet the old girl will do 130 mph with that.
